Heavy metal pollution, ecological risk, spatial distribution, and source identification in sediments of the Lijiang River, China

He Xiao et al.

Summary: This study collected 61 sediment samples along the Lijiang River to analyze pollution levels and ecological risks. The results showed high concentrations of Cd, Hg, Zn, and Pb in the river sediments, with the midstream area being the most polluted and posing a higher potential ecological risk, primarily due to urbanization and agricultural activities.

The Niederschlag fluorite-(barite) deposit, Erzgebirge/Germany-a fluid inclusion and trace element study

Sebastian Haschke et al.

Summary: The Niederschlag fluorite-barite vein deposit in the Western Erzgebirge, Germany, has been actively mined since 2013. The study identified two different stages of fluorite mineralization with distinct characteristics. The fluid inclusions and REY systematics of the two stages of fluorite show significant differences in their properties and compositions.

Health risk assessment based on source identification of heavy metals: A case study of Beiyun River, China

Huihui Wu et al.

Summary: In this study, Beiyun River was used as an example to quantitatively identify pollution sources and assess pollution source-oriented health risks related to heavy metals. The results showed that heavy metal pollution in the midstream and downstream of Beiyun River is more serious, with arsenic and nickel posing serious health risks to local residents. Industrial activities were identified as the largest contributor to heavy metal pollution in Beiyun River. The findings provide important insights for the precise control of pollution sources to improve water environment management in the basin.

Vertical Zoning in Hydrothermal U-Ag-Bi-Co-Ni-As Systems: A Case Study from the Annaberg-Buchholz District, Erzgebirge (Germany)

Marie Guilcher et al.

Summary: The Annaberg-Buchholz district in Germany is a typical occurrence of hydrothermal five-element veins, with multiple mineralization stages recognized in polyphase veins. Uranium and five-element mineralization stages are found in the upper 400 meters below surface, coinciding with a specific lithology, while fluorite-barite-Pb-Zn mineralization occurs throughout the vertical profile of the district. The observed vertical zoning is attributed to hydrothermal remobilization rather than being a primary feature.
